The first NRW children‘s tournament in Düsseldorf

News-66-cover

On Sunday the 15th of May 2022, more than 160 children participated in the first NRW children's tournament that was hosted at our club facilities. Many teams from various cities around Düsseldorf came to compete for a brilliant day of rugby.
The day was a big success for the Dragons on the pitch, with our two U8 teams finishing in first and second place. First place was also taken by a motivated U10 team, eager to win at home. The official U10 matches were followed by a spontaneously organised friendly match, played by two mixed teams from various clubs. The match was played with great enthusiasm and ended in a draw. A wonderful rugby moment!

For our U12 team, this tournament had great importance as it was the last chance to play competitively in preparation for the upcoming German U12 Rugby Championship in Berlin. Our U12 played well, but could not secure the win against a stronger team of RSV Köln and earned a good second place in the tournament.

The day was tougher for our U14, who joined with players from RC Aachen, to play two long games in very warm weather conditions. They finished in third position of the three teams present but nonetheless had a lot of fun while also gaining more experience.

The tournament took place on a beautiful hot and sunny day and players and spectators alike could enjoy the food and drinks prepared for them. The burger stand was a great success, but not as popular as the delicious ice cream provided by well-received local ice cream makers Ghirloni 😊.
